Course structure

• Introduction to Islamic Ethics in Accounting
• Islamic Financial Reporting Standards
• Corporate Governance in Islamic Finance
• Ethics in Zakat and Charity Accounting
• Islamic Business Ethics
• Professional Ethics in Islamic Accounting
• Ethical Decision Making in Islamic Accounting
• Islamic Ethics in Auditing
• Ethics in Islamic Banking and Finance
• Case Studies in Ethics in Islamic Accounting

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Islamic Accountant Ensure financial transactions comply with Islamic principles
Ethical Auditor Conduct audits to ensure ethical practices in accounting
Compliance Officer Ensure adherence to ethical standards and regulations
Financial Analyst Analyze financial data and provide insights for ethical decision-making
Risk Manager Identify and mitigate ethical risks in financial operations
